House Telvanni

Doctrine
The strong shall rule. Advancement is earned through sorcery and cunning, never through petition or politics.

House Telvanni is a reclusive faction of sorcerer-nobles who govern from the tops of enormous living mushroom towers grown from magical spores. They have little interest in the outside world and less in political alliance. Each master operates as a sovereign unto themselves, connected to the House by tradition and mutual contempt for other factions rather than any genuine unity.

House Hlaalu

Doctrine
Wealth and influence are the only real power. Bribery, trade, and Imperial cooperation sustain House Hlaalu's dominance.

Hlaalu is the most Imperially aligned of the Great Houses, having cultivated close ties with the Empire since their arrival in Morrowind. They dominate the western half of Vvardenfell, operating from Balmora and the great canton of Vivec. Their power is mercantile and political, built on a network of bribes, informants, and trade agreements with mainland merchants.

House Redoran

Doctrine
Duty, honor, and valor above all. The warrior caste of Morrowind, born defenders of Dunmer tradition and the Ghostfence.

House Redoran governs from Ald'ruhn, a city built beneath the shell of a dead Emperor Crab on the edge of the Ashlands. Their nobles are warrior-aristocrats who maintain the Ghostfence patrols and consider their proximity to Red Mountain not a curse but a sacred duty. Redoran honor is the kind that bleeds quietly rather than complains.

House Indoril

Doctrine
The Tribunal are living gods and must be obeyed in all things. Indoril is the Temple's secular arm, its wealth, and its sword.

Once the most powerful of all Great Houses, Indoril's influence has declined since the Empire's arrival made direct theocratic governance untenable. They remain wealthy and culturally dominant through their inseparable connection to the Tribunal Temple, their vast network of clergy, and the feared Ordinators—their golden-masked warrior-monks who enforce Temple law with exceptional violence.
